Questions & Answers

Q: What is the purpose of Astronomy Night at the White House?

Astronomy Night at the White House aims to inspire young people to become interested in space and science and to pursue careers in STEM fields.

Q: What commitments and initiatives are announced during Astronomy Night?

President Obama announces new commitments by cities and organizations to expose more students and parents to STEM education. For example, Baylor is launching a national effort to help parents and children work on science and engineering projects together, and over 300 foundations, libraries, and schools are partnering to bring hands-on science programming to students.

Q: How is President Obama encouraging young people to enter STEM fields?

President Obama emphasizes the need for teachers to spark curiosity in young minds, and he urges parents to support their children's interest in science by providing resources and opportunities for exploration. He also highlights his administration's efforts to train more STEM teachers and provide high-speed internet access to students.

Q: What recent achievements in space exploration are mentioned during the event?

President Obama mentions recent discoveries such as water flowing on Mars, the detailed mapping of Pluto, and the first detection of an Earth-sized planet orbiting a star in a distant galaxy. He also mentions NASA's plans to send humans to Mars in the 2030s.
